How much is Patrick Getreide's watch collection worth?
That first CHF400 Omega (about $1,400 today) began a collection that now contains some 600 timepieces and is valued by Christie's at more than $300 million. A few years after that first purchase, Getreide left school because his father was too sick to run his business. “I was young and made mistakes,” he says.

What is the oak collection?
The Oak Collection is an acronym of 'One of a Kind', and a significant number of the watches to be offered here are indeed 'one of a kind'.
